Schindler's Factory
Schindler's Factory is now a museum that narrates the history of Krakow during World War II and the Holocaust. Admission costs around $6 (25 PLN), and it's open from 10 AM to 6 PM. This museum is essential for understanding the impact of the war on the city and those who lived through it.

Schindler's Factory is a museum located in the former enamelware factory of Oskar Schindler, who saved over a thousand Jews during the Holocaust.
The museum plays a crucial role in preserving the memory of the past and educating visitors about the impact of WWII.
You’ll see exhibits detailing the lives of those affected by the war and the history of Krakow during this period.
Admission is about $6, and it's best to visit on weekdays to avoid long lines.
